A brief summary of Jackson Bridge in West Yorkshire

Jackson Bridge is a quaint village located in the Holme Valley civil parish, part of the Metropolitan Borough of Kirklees in West Yorkshire. Conveniently positioned alongside the A616 road, which connects Huddersfield to Penistone, this area may present unique opportunities for planning applications related to residential and commercial developments. The settlement has a population of approximately 1,380. It sits within the Holme Valley district.

Property prices in Jackson Bridge show an average sale price of £267,561, based on 50 recent transactions recorded by HM Land Registry.

There were no crimes reported in the immediate area during the most recent reporting period. This makes Jackson Bridge a particularly low-crime area.

Jackson Bridge has 4 conservation areas within its boundaries: Hepworth, Butterley, Fulstone, Totties. Planning applications within or near these conservation areas are subject to additional scrutiny to preserve the architectural and historic character of the area. Homeowners and developers should be aware that permitted development rights may be restricted.

Ecology & Nature Designations

The area around Jackson Bridge includes 3 Ancient Woodland sites. These designations may affect planning decisions, as proposals near protected sites require environmental impact assessment and may face additional restrictions.

Planning Activity in Jackson Bridge

In the last 24 months, 22 planning applications were submitted near Jackson Bridge. Of these, 100% were approved, with an average decision time of 50 days.

This is notably above the national average of approximately 87%, suggesting a relatively permissive planning environment. Applicants near Jackson Bridge may find that well-prepared applications have a strong chance of success.

The average decision time of 50 days is within the government's 8-week statutory target for minor applications, indicating an efficient planning department.

The most common application types near Jackson Bridge were full planning applications (6), tree works (6), outline applications (2). Full planning applications account for 27% of all submissions, covering new builds, change of use, and works that go beyond permitted development rights.

In terms of development scale, 1 medium-scale application, 18 smaller schemes were submitted.
